发明名称 Data recording components and processes for acquiring selected web site data
摘要 Embodiments of the components and processes for recording selected Web site data described herein adhere to long-term stability guidelines so as to improve maintainability and viability over time. Additionally, the data recording components can be placed within a software architecture to minimize the number of redundant data recording components. Furthermore, the data recording components can be tailored to specific data recording purposes. Additionally, the data recording components can be designed to take into account system performance issues and minimally impact system performance. Furthermore, the data recording components can be tailored to gather specific data useful for various analytical processes. Additionally, embodiments of the data recording components are relatively easy to implement and able to handle idiosyncrasies and changes of various Web sites in which they are placed.
申请公布号 US9390190(B1) 申请公布日期 2016.07.12
申请号 US201414189576 申请日期 2014.02.25
申请人 Versata Development Group, Inc. 发明人 Schwartz Elizabeth M.;Karipides Daniel P.
分类号 G06F15/177;G06F17/30;H04L29/08;H04L12/26;G06F11/30;G06F11/34;G06Q30/02 主分类号 G06F15/177
代理机构 Terrile, Cannatti, Chambers & Holland, LLP 代理人 Terrile, Cannatti, Chambers & Holland, LLP ;Chambers Kent B.
主权项 1. A method of recording data generated during a user Web site session, the method comprising: executing a program by a computer system that transforms the computer system into a specialized machine to perform: capturing Web site session data using data recording components placed in multiple layers of server-side software for maintainability and viability of the server-side software, wherein the data recording components are placed in multiple layers in server-side software, the data recording components in the multiple layers are placed (i) in deep layers of the server-side software for inter-layer depth and (ii) in intra-layer locations deep within the layers for intra-layer depth and: each of the deep layers for inter-layer depth is a layer whose content is more stable over time relative to content in at least a plurality of other layers that do not have the data recording components, andfor each of the intra-layer locations deep within the layers for intra-layer depth, content for the locations deep in the layer is more stable over time relative to content of at least a plurality of other locations in the same layer; andrecording data for at least analytical processes, wherein the data is recorded in a memory and generated during the user Web site session using the data recording components.
地址 Austin TX US